Abstract

Objective Based on the experimental study to the characteristics of organic composition of sweat changes in humid heat environment, the purpose to reveal people's physical adaptation ability of sport in humid heat environment and to provide the theoretical basis for the training. Methods We randomly selected 30 healthy volunteers from one university, whose average age was (21.3±1.1) years , without major diseases. The trialwas conducted in Humid Heat Environment Training Laboratory of The Second Military Medical University, at environment temperature 39℃, relative humidity 80%, training cycle 7 consecutive days, and training process in accordance with the principle of gradual and orderly progress. With Thermo Scientific iCAP 6000 Series ICP, we analyzed the composition of sweat collected during training and stored in the refrigerator. Rectal temperature was measured after training. Results Till the seventh day, the concentration of Urea,La,Na+,K+,and Cl- in sweat all declined from the first day(P<0.05). In addition to the concentration of La slowly declining on the sixth day, all others reached the minimum value on the sixth day, then there was an obvious trend of subsequent rise. Conclusions At least six days are needed for a hot and humid environment acclimatization training based on this trial design.
